Our deep desire as ministering vessels of the Holy Spirit 🕊️ is for everyone listening to the Good News of Salvation, which we continuously proclaim, to experience the same faith, peace, and conviction we possess (Eph. 1:13). Standing firm in our convictions and wanting others to experience what brings us joy and purpose, helps us in the fulfilment of the Great Commission (Matt. 28:18-20, Heb. 10:23). 🌍
However, anyone without the desire for others who are listening or receiving his ministrations, to become such as he is in Christ Jesus, is probably not faithful to their calling (1 Cor. 11:1, Gal. 4:19, Col. 1:28, 1 Thess. 2:8)📖. So, ensure you are willing to stay fruitful 🍇 by discipling as many as you are given so that you may be found worthy of Christ (John. 15:8, Phil. 1:27).
